Ceph是一个开源的分布式存储系统,它主要用于处理大规模的存储需求。在部署Ceph时,通常会使用自动化工具来简化安装过程。但有时候,我们可能需要手动安装Ceph来更灵活地配置系统。接下来,我们将介绍如何手动安装Ceph。

首先,我们需要准备好一台运行最新版本的CentOS或者Ubuntu操作系统的服务器。在安装Ceph之前,我们需要安装一些必要的软件依赖。这些软件包括:ntp(用于同步系统时间)、openssh-server(用于远程登录)、python2(Ceph的安装脚本依赖Python2)、和其他一些常见的软件包。

安装完成软件依赖后,我们需要下载Ceph的安装脚本。可以去Ceph的官方网站或者Github上找到最新的安装脚本。下载完成后,将安装脚本解压到服务器的任意目录。

接下来,我们需要配置Ceph集群的网络和存储设备。在Ceph的配置文件中,我们需要指定每台服务器的角色(Monitor、OSD、MDS等)、网络信息(IP地址、子网掩码、网关等)、以及存储设备(磁盘和分区)的信息。这些配置信息将决定Ceph集群的规模和性能。

配置完成后,我们可以运行安装脚本来部署Ceph集群。安装脚本将自动在每台服务器上安装Ceph的各个组件,并配置集群的网络和存储设备。整个安装过程可能需要一段时间,取决于集群的规模和性能。

安装完成后,我们可以使用Ceph的命令行工具来管理和监控集群。通过命令行工具,我们可以创建存储池、上传文件、监控集群状态等。此外,Ceph还提供了REST API和Web管理界面,方便用户进行远程管理和监控。

总的来说,手动安装Ceph可能比自动化工具更复杂,但它也更灵活,并且可以更好地满足特定的需求。通过本文的介绍,相信您已经掌握了手动安装Ceph的基本步骤和注意事项。祝您成功部署Ceph集群!